Create a New Scenario to Connect Google Meet and Mautic
In the workspace, click the “Create New Scenario” button.
Add the First Step
Add the first node – a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a Google Meet,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, Google Meet or Mautic will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find Google Meet or Mautic,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Save and Activate the Scenario
After configuring Google Meet, Mautic, and any additional nodes, don’t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.
Test the Scenario
Run the scenario by clicking “Run once” and triggering an event to check if the Google Meet and Mautic integ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between Google Meet and Mautic (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.
Google Meet + Mautic + Slack: When a meeting is scheduled in Google Meet, the recording link is sent to Mautic as a contact update. Then, a Slack message notifies the marketing team about the meeting and the contact that needs follow-up.
Mautic + Calendly + Google Meet: When a new lead is created in Mautic, they receive a Calendly link. When the lead books a meeting through Calendly (invitee created), a Google Meet event is automatically scheduled.
